The structure of Sunlight Loophole Sync lies in understanding and leveraging the fundamental homes of sunshine past mere lighting or power generation. Among the most engaging applications is in the world of passive solar layout in architecture. By creating buildings and city spaces that normally manage temperature through sunshine management, we can substantially reduce the requirement for man-made home heating in wintertime and cooling in summer season. This approach includes calculated placement of windows, choice of products with desirable thermal mass properties, and landscape design that enhances these layouts. For circumstances, a building placed to record the low-angle winter season sun while decreasing direct exposure throughout the warm summer season can maintain a lot more regular inner temperatures, lowering power intake substantially. In addition, including photovoltaic or pv glass, which not just produces power but likewise adjusts its opacity to reduce heat gain, showcases exactly how cutting-edge modern technology and standard style concepts can operate in tandem to make use of the Sunlight Loophole Sync totally.
